1.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
What is a dust storm?
Back
A dust storm is a meteorological phenomenon where strong winds lift and carry large amounts of dust and sand from the ground, reducing visibility and air quality.
2.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
What was the Dust Bowl?
Back
The Dust Bowl was a period in the 1930s when severe drought and poor agricultural practices led to massive dust storms in the Southern Plains of the United States, greatly affecting farming.
3.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
What are the main causes of dust storms?
Back
Dust storms are primarily caused by strong winds, dry soil, and lack of vegetation, which can be exacerbated by drought conditions.
4.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
How do dust storms affect the environment?
Back
Dust storms can degrade air quality, harm wildlife, damage crops, and contribute to soil erosion.
5.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
What is the Soil Conservation Act?
Back
The Soil Conservation Act is a law passed by Congress in response to the Dust Bowl, aimed at promoting soil conservation practices to prevent erosion and protect farmland.
6.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
What role did Congress play during the Dust Bowl?
Back
Congress passed legislation, such as the Soil Conservation Act, to address the environmental and economic challenges posed by the Dust Bowl.
7.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
What is the significance of the phrase 'like a giant locomotive' in literature?
Back
This phrase is used to create a sense of danger and urgency, often describing the overwhelming force of a dust storm.
